Why Buy a Folding Treadmill?

Folding treadmills are an excellent option for those with a limited space or cleaning abilities. It is less difficult to clean and occupies less space than a non-folding model.

jupgod-folding-treadmill-2-5hp-under-desk-treadmill-adjustable-speeds-1-10km-h-walking-running-machine-for-home-cardio-exercise-black-18.jpgCertain models come with incline settings which simulate uphill terrain to increase your workout intensity and burning calories. Many models also include tracking features and smartphone compatibility to monitor workout metrics.

It will save you lots of space

Foldable treadmills are a great option for those who don't have plenty of space for their fitness equipment. They are smaller than traditional treadmills and can be easily hidden under the desk or in a corner. They don't offer the same level of stability as non-folding treadmills. They are also a bit more difficult to move around the house after you've finished your workout.

Check the manufacturer's site to determine how easy it is to fold and unfold a treadmill. If it is difficult to fold and unfold, you may want to reconsider the purchase. Check the maximum capacity of the weight and safety rails to prevent accidents. It is also important to leave enough space behind your treadmill, as it is risky to get trapped in the belt when it is moving. Easy to store away

Folding treadmills are a great alternative if you don't wish to invest in a traditional model. They come in a variety of compact designs and folding mechanisms to help them to be easier to store away. Some fold upwards towards the frame, while others fold down so that the entire treadmill can be placed under a table or desk at home. Some models come with integrated carry handles and wheels that make it easy to move.

If your treadmill folds with a lock on the deck that is manual, to fold it up simply grasp it with a firm grip on the back of the deck and then lift it up until it locks in position. The console and handlebars can be unfolded. Certain models come with hydraulics that lift the deck and fold it down automatically making the process more simple.

When purchasing a folding treadmill be sure to consider the speed and incline settings and safety features. If you intend to run on your treadmill, look for a model with the maximum speed of 12 miles per hour. A treadmill with a higher maximum speed will allow you to run faster and get a better workout.

Take into consideration the size of the deck on the treadmill. Deck sizes between 55 and 60 inches. are ideal for joggers or runners, as they allow for a wide range of strides. Some models have incline capabilities, but these are more common in non-folding treadmills and generally cost more.

A treadmill fold flat's construction is also crucial. The frame must be sturdy enough to stand up to repeated use. Make sure you have a belt that is sturdy as well as a safety bar, and an emergency stop clip. These are vital for safety and will ensure that your treadmill lasts longer.

If you want treadmills that take up as little space as feasible in your home, choose one that folds flat, not at an angle. This will help you save storage space and make it much easier to slide under your couch or bed when it's not in use. Some treadmills come with transport wheels so you can easily move the treadmill between rooms.

Folding treadmills are great for compact spaces, but they're not as sturdy as non-folding treadmills. This means that they are more likely to wobble when running at high speeds. However, there are some ways to prevent this problem for example, using an exercise mat under the machine and regularly cleaning it.
